Class TypeFactory
Inject this factory into other components when you need to perform an object creation based on a
known TypeSupplier. TypeSuppliers are purposefully non-descriptive in regard to type in
order to avoid premature recognition by the classloader. Since one of the primary use cases for
the TypeFactory is to provide domain object instances (either the framework type, or a more
derived type described by an extension), it is interesting to avoid classloader recognition of
the domain type to early, which would thwart load time weaving (LTW) concerns. Broadleaf does not
employ LTW, but a given implementation that leverages the framework may. See TypeSupplier
for docs on how to setup a type supplier, either for a new custom type, or to override an
out-of-the-box type supplier provided by Broadleaf.
As this TypeFactory is initialized, TypeSuppliers that appear later
in the list overwrite TypeSupplier values supplied earlier.

get
Get a new instance of the requested type based on the the configured suppliers. The requested type being passed in is used as a key to look at the configured
TypeSuppliers to determine the concrete instance to create.If there is no
TypeSupplierconfigured, the type will attempt to be instantiated using its zero-argument constructor (using reflection to make thispublicif needed). If there is no such constructor or the type is an abstract class or interface, anis thrown.- Type Parameters:
T- The type that is instantiated- Parameters:
type- Class describing the type to instantiate. Usually a superclass or interface- Returns:
- An instance of the type. Will throw IllegalArgumentException if no supporting
TypeSupplieris found or if the given class cannot be instantiated - Throws:
IllegalArgumentException- if the giventypecannot be constructed

getMostDerivedMapping
Determine from this factory the most derived type from all of the
TypeSuppliersavailable.This method traverses by continually using a looked-up class as a key to determine if there is a more specific derived type to use.
If there is no
TypeSupplier.TypeMappingpresent for the giventype, the original is returned.- Parameters:
type- Class describing the type to instantiate. Usually a superclass or interface- Returns:
- the most derived type in the factory or the given type if there are no type suppliers configured

getHighestLevelMapping
Determine from this factory the most top-level type from all of theTypeSuppliersavailable.This method first looks at the
classMappingsReverseLookupCache, if no cache exists for the given type, then it traversesclassMappingscontinually to determine if there is a more specific top-level type to use.If there is no
TypeSupplier.TypeMappingpresent for the giventype, the original is returned.- Parameters:
type- class type to find the highest level type- Returns:
- the highest level type in the factory or the given type if there are no type suppliers configured
